WebThe hormone is given as a single daily injection, which can usually be done by a parent, carer, or by the child when they're old enough. Skin reactions are the most commonly reported side effect. In very rare cases, the treatment is associated with persistent severe headaches, vomiting and vision problems. WebA growth hormone (GH) stimulation test checks if your child’s body is making enough growth hormone. Growth hormone helps children grow taller. Growth hormone also affects metabolism (how the body uses and stores fat). How long does a GH test last? A GH test lasts between 2 ½ and 5 hours. http://ifrj.upm.edu.my/25%20(01)%202424/(1).pdf
